Eileen The Making of Orwell is the first on this extraordinary woman who has been until now unjustly overlooked. It examines the Blairs' nine year marriage, from a tiny village where they grew vegetables and tended their own goats and chickens, through the dangers of the Spanish Civil War, nursing George in Morocco after a severe bout of tubercular bleeding, narrowly escaping the destruction of their London apartment in World War II, and even adopting a baby boy when it became apparent that they were unable to have their own child. And their partnership produced some of the greatest works in English literature. Now, George told a friend the night he met Eileen O'Shaughnessy, that's the kind of girl I would like to marry. The year before, Eileen had published a futuristic poem called End of the Century, 1984. Later, George would name his greatest work, 1984, in homage to the memory of Eileen.
